Features

Issuer Marquisate of Provence (French States)
Marquess Raymond V (1148-1194)
Raymond VI (1194-1222)
Raymond VII (1222-1249)
Type Standard circulation coins
Years 1151-1249
Value 1 Pite (1⁄20)
Currency Denier
Composition Bilon
Weight 0.20 g
Diameter 10 mm
Shape Okrągły (nieregularny)
Technique Młotkowana
Orientation Variable alignment ↺
Demonetized Yes

Obverse

Krzyż Toulouse.Automatically translated

Script: łaciński

Lettering: R C PA

Unabridged legend: Raimondus Comes Palatii

Reverse

Ośmioramienna gwiazda na półksiężycu.Automatically translated

Script: łaciński

Lettering: M P D N

Unabridged legend: Dux Marchio Provinciae

Mint

Pont-de-Sorgue, modern-day Sorgues, Francja (1148-1354)
